Abstract

Summary: One uncommon but extremely aggressive kind of gestational trophoblastic neoplasia (GTN) is postpartum choriocarcinoma. Its clinical manifestation frequently resembles typical subsequent postpartum hemorrhage sources, which could impede identification and raise maternal morbidity.

Case Presentation:

A woman with a history of three prior cesarean sections appeared with recurring severe vaginal bleeding. Twelve days after an emergency cesarean delivery, Conservative management was started after an initial examination revealed retained products of conception. However, hypovolemic shock caused the patient's condition to worsen. Suspicion of GTN was raised by significantly high levels of β-human chorionic gonadotropin (β- hCG) in the serum and pelvic magnetic resonance imaging. An urgent surgical procedure was carried out since the bleeding was potentially fatal.
